Textual thesaurus for "halter"

(noun) balancer, haltere

either of the rudimentary hind wings of dipterous insects; used for maintaining equilibrium during flight


(noun) hackamore

rope or canvas headgear for a horse, with a rope for leading


(noun) hangman's halter, hangman's rope, hemp, hempen necktie

a rope that is used by a hangman to execute persons who have been condemned to death by hanging


(verb) hamper, strangle, cramp

prevent the progress or free movement of

He was hampered in his efforts by the bad weather; the imperialist nation wanted to strangle the free trade between the two small countries
